The Drought in Charlotte NC Hasn't Gone Anywhere

Here in Charlotte and Mecklenburg County, we are still classified as under "Exceptional Drought" Conditions according to the latest update from the NC Drought Management Advisory Council's latest update on February 5, 2008. They have a statewide map of current drought conditions here.
While we have seen some rain in Charlotte over the last month or two, it has not solved the drought issue, all it's really done is postpone any further water restrictions for the time being.
Currently in Charlotte and Mecklenburg County, we're under mandatory water restrictions which have not changed since September. Watering lawns or use of sprinkler systems is still not allowed. There is no warning given for violations - they'll just send you the bill for the penalty which starts at $100 for residential customers and increases for repeat offenses.
For further details on what specifically is and is not allowed under the current water restrictions the county utilities website has a page devoted to explaining the restrictions, penalties, and encouraged conservation methods.
It does seem like we've been living with the current drought situation for quite a while now, and its important to remember that even though we're getting occasional rain, the overall water situation is far from ideal and will take time to recover from the significant depletion we've experienced.

Charlotte NC Real Estate - Beverly Woods Closed Sales

Beverly Woods Closed Sales Jan 07-Jan 08
As the chart above illustrates, market activity for closed listings has shown a spike in closings around May/June and then again in Sept/October but there was at least one closed listing in each month.
Looking at additional stats for the January 2007-January 2008 period:
Average Sales Price: $337,211
Average Days on Market: 29
Average Percent of Sales Price Compared to List Price: 98%

So, homes in Beverly Woods on average were under contract within 30 days and sold for very close to list price, based on the past 13 months of activity.

This information is simply a snapshot and general overview of the neighborhood market, it is not a market analysis, which requires much further depth, application of information and consideration of a given property.

Charlotte NC Homes - Beverly Woods Market Report 2.7.08


Beverly Woods Current Market Activity as of 2.7.08

Listings Status# of ListingsAvg List PriceAvg Square FeetAvg Days on Market
Current Active Listings12$350,058207884
Current Pending Listings3$320,766177346
Current Conditional/Contingent Listings0n/an/an/a

The current List Prices in Beverly Woods range from $299,000 to $499,900.
The 3 Pending listings are ranch style homes, and two of those went under contract in less than 10 days....not bad for the fall/winter season!
Beverly Woods is a neighborhood of single family homes, situated between Sharon Rd and Park South Dr, just south of Fairview Rd and is located just about a mile from South Park mall and Phillips Place.
The majority of homes were built in the 1960's into the early 1970's and styles include ranch, split level, 1.5 story, and 2 story homes. Mature shade trees and landscaping, generous property sizes, and a prime South Park location central to South Park, the Harris YMCA, the new light rail line, as well as Uptown Charlotte all add to the appeal of Beverly Woods.

Charlotte NC Real Estate - Olde Providence Closed Sales

Olde Providence Sales 2007-2008
Looking at the Chart above, the busiest months for closed sales in Olde Providence for the past year have been in the spring and summer months but activity has not been stagnant even in other seasons.
The Average Sales Pricesince January 2007 in the Olde Providence neighborhood was $265,700
Average Days on Market was 47
Average Square footage
was 2046
Looking at how sales prices compared to list prices, the Average Sales Price/List Price was 97% so the closed listings sold for quite close to their list prices.

Of course, all of this data is simply a general analysis and is just a snapshot of the market activity for Olde Providence since January of 2007. This is not a market analysis, which requires much more in depth analysis and application of the market data to a given property.

Charlotte NC Homes - Olde Providence Market Report 2.6.08

OLDE PROVIDENCE MARKET ACTIVITY AS OF 2.6.08

Listing StatusNumber of ListingsAverage List PriceAverage Square FeetAverage Days on Market
Current Active Listings11$294,309217268
Current Pending Listings2$274,900223066
Current Conditional/Contingent Listings1$289,900215020

Olde Providence is located in the heart of South Charlotte, convenient to South Park, the Arboretum, and I-485. Tree-lined streets that wind gracefully through the neighborhood, mature landscaping and houses with generous property sizes make this neighborhood a hidden gem. The majority of homes were built in the 1960's and into the 1970's and many have been beautifully renovated and updated.
Current active listings in Olde Providence range in price from $225,000 to $370,000. Home styles include ranches, split levels and two story homes.
